Phil Graham, IV, PLA, ASLA

Managing Principal and President

Phil is an award-winning professional landscape architect and fifth generation pioneering family of St. Petersburg. Phil's professional practice began in Phoenix after earning a Bachelor of Landscape Architecture from the University of Florida, continuing his practice in Chicago for more than a decade before returning to join the firm in 2007, achieving full ownership as managing principal in 2013. His thoughtful graphic and written communication skills, along with an in-depth understanding of industry-related trends and technologies contribute to collaborative, award-winning projects. Phil's extensive world travel has influenced his multi-dimensional approach to meaningful design that connects people with outdoor environments. He is a member of the American Society of Landscape Architects, previously serving on the Florida Chapter Government Affairs Committee. Phil serves as Secretary on the Board of Directors for the Waterfront Parks Foundation and is a board member of the Pioneer Park Foundation.


Phil Graham, Jr., FASLA

Founder, Retired

Phil Graham, Jr. (retired) is an award-winning professional landscape architect and former certified planner, widely acknowledged for design excellence, uniquely combining the beautiful, the functional and the enduring. He is a Fellow in the American Society of Landscape Architects. Phil has a B.A. Degree in Business Administration from Eckerd College. He served honorably in the United States Marine Corps. In 2012, Phil founded the St. Petersburg Waterfront Parks Foundation.
